About Jamtha Village

Jamtha is a mid sized village in Reodar tehsil, in the district of Sirohi, Rajasthan.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 892, made up of 464 males and 428 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 922 females per 1000 males. The village covers 589 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 307514,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Jamtha

The census records public bus service for Jamtha as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
